Arsenal News: Manchester United think Mesut Ozil has a problem with Arsene Wenger

Ozil looks likely to leave Arsenal either in January or the end of the season with his contract expiring in July.

Manchester United have emerged as a shock destination, with Red Devils boss Jose Mourinho a fan of the Germany international. 

Mourinho managed the player while at Real Madrid, helping Ozil become a household name in La Liga.

And Spanish outlet Don Balon claims the 54-year-old is aware that the Arsenal star is keen to leave so he can play under someone other than Wenger. 

It is said the Red Devils manager feels Ozil has a problem plying his trade under the Frenchman and that is why he is seeking a new challenge elsewhere.

Don Balon add United are keen on the World Cup winner for two reasons.

They supposedly feel he would strengthen their ranks, despite having Juan Mata and Henrikh Mkhitaryan at their disposal.

Mkhitaryan, in particular, has started the season in breathtaking form but his fine displays may not deter Mourinho from strengthening in his position.

Additionally, Mourinho would also love to weaken another direct rival.

Meanwhile, former Arsenal star Stewart Robson thinks the Gunners would be open to selling Ozil should they receive an offer for him in January.

“I think they’re at that stage (where they want to sell Ozil in January),” Robson said.

“Ozil has shown no indication to sign a contract at Arsenal. 

“The problem that Arsenal have if they do want to sell him is that he is on so much money, is there going to be another club willing to pay him the sort of money that he would want? 

“So that’s going to be their major problem.”
